Factors Associated with Short Hospital Stay After Combined Middle Meningeal Artery Embolization and Surgical Evacuation for Chronic Subdural Hematoma.

Abstract
BACKGROUND: Middle meningeal artery embolization (MMAE) plus surgical evacuation is increasingly used for chronic subdural hematoma (cSDH), but predictors of length of stay (LOS) and outcomes associated with early discharge remain unclear.
METHODS: We performed a multicenter MESH Registry study (2019-2024) of patients undergoing MMAE and surgical evacuation for symptomatic cSDH. Short-stay discharge was defined as LOS ≤4 days. Predictors were identified using multivariable logistic regression. The 90-day composite adverse event was defined as cSDH recurrence requiring intervention, reintervention (repeat MMAE or surgical evacuation), or 30-day all-cause readmission. Safety was assessed using adjusted logistic regression, generalized estimating equations (GEE), inverse probability of treatment weighting (IPTW), and multiple imputation by chained equations (MICE).
RESULTS: Among 647 patients (mean age 72.6 years; 74.0% male), 156 (24.1%) had short-stay discharge. Median LOS was 8 days (IQR 5-15). Older age (aOR 0.76 per 10 years; 95% CI 0.62-0.93; P = 0.008), higher baseline modified Rankin Scale score (aOR 0.79 per point; 95% CI 0.67-0.94; P = 0.007), and greater midline shift (aOR 0.90 per mm; 95% CI 0.85-0.96; P = 0.001) were independently associated with lower odds of short-stay discharge. C‑statistic was 0.683. The 90-day composite event rate was 17.1% in short-stay versus 23.7% in long-stay patients. Short-stay discharge was not significantly associated with the composite outcome on adjusted analysis (aOR 0.56; 95% CI 0.30-1.07; P = 0.08), GEE (aOR 0.61; 95% CI 0.33-1.12; P = 0.11), or MICE (aOR 0.74; 95% CI 0.44-1.25; P = 0.26). IPTW showed a discordant association (OR 0.47; 95% CI 0.24-0.92; P = 0.03).
CONCLUSIONS: Older age, worse baseline function, and midline shift were associated with longer hospitalization. Short-stay discharge was not associated with a statistically significant increase in adverse-event rates; however, the study was not powered to establish non-inferiority or safety equivalence, and clinically meaningful differences cannot be excluded.
